Player Controls:

Movement:

  • Forward: W (Walk or run depending on toggle run/walk setting)
  • Backward: S
  • Left: A (Walk or run left. Tap twice for a side roll left.)
  • Right: D (Walk or run right. Tap twice for a side roll right.)
  • Toggle Run/Walk: Shift + W

Actions:

  • Crouch: Right Ctrl
  • Cycle Weapon Up: Mouse Wheel Scroll (Mouse Axis Z)
  • Cycle Weapon Down: Mouse Wheel Scroll (Mouse Axis Z)
  • Hide Weapon: H
  • Drop Weapon: Backspace
  • Reload: L (Tommy loses bullets of rejected cylinder/magazine/cartridge. Perform a quick reload by doing a side roll after starting to reload. Reloads automatically if the last bullet is fired and an unused cylinder/magazine/cartridge is available.)
  • Sniper Mode: S
  • Inventory: I
  • Objectives: F1
  • City Map: Tab
  • Skip cutscene (a non-interactive cinematic the game plays automatically): Enter
  • Pause menu: Esc
  • Punch/Throw: Left Mouse Button (LMB)

Shooting Mechanics:

  • Hold LMB to have Tommy aim for a few seconds before firing. He will continue firing, reloading if possible, until LMB is released or ammo is depleted.
  • Quick Shots (e.g., Shotgun): Hold Backward key, then hold Fire key while simultaneously pressing Jump key. Fire rate depends on how fast you tap the Jump key.

Car Controls:

  • Accelerate: Cursor Up (Can also be used to start ignition)
  • Brake/Reverse: Cursor Down
  • Steer Left: Cursor Left
  • Steer Right: Cursor Right
  • Handbrake: Space
  • Horn: K (Peds and vehicles move out of the way. Affects police if speeding.)
  • Look Left: ,
  • Look Right: .
  • Speed Limiter: F5 (Limits car to 40 mph until main story completion, then 60 mph. Helps avoid police trouble for speeding.)
  • Manual/Automatic Gears: M (Indicated by M or A on a disk in the bottom right of the screen. Manual allows faster acceleration.)
  • Use Clutch (Manual Transmission): X (Press while using manual transmission and changing gears.)
  • Change Gears Up: A
  • Change Gears Down: Z
  • Replace Race Car (Fairplay race): Numpad 0 (Uprights Tommy's car.)
  • Change Camera: C (Cycles through six forward-aimed camera positions: above/behind, farther back, even farther back, front fender, in front of windshield, beside back of left front fender. Can be combined with Q and/or E.)
  • City Map: Tab
